在Ubuntu系统中配置Oracle网络,通常涉及到设置静态IP地址、网关、DNS服务器等。以下是一个基本的网络配置步骤,假设你使用的是Ubuntu Server版本。
首先,你需要知道你的网络接口名称。可以使用以下命令查看:
ip link show
通常,以太网接口会被命名为如 eth0 或 ens33 等。
Ubuntu的网络配置文件通常位于 /etc/netplan/ 目录下,文件名可能是 01-netcfg.yaml、50-cloud-init.yaml 或其他以 yaml 结尾的文件。使用你喜欢的文本编辑器打开它,例如使用 nano:
sudo nano /etc/netplan/50-cloud-init.yaml
在配置文件中,你可以为每个网络接口设置静态IP地址。以下是一个示例配置:
network:
  version: 2
  ethernets:
    enp0s3:  # 替换为你的以太网接口名称
      dhcp4: no
      addresses: [192.168.1.102/24]  # 设置静态IP地址
      gateway4: 192.168.1.1  # 设置网关
      nameservers:
        addresses: [8.8.8.8]  # 设置DNS服务器
保存文件后,运行以下命令使配置生效:
sudo netplan apply
你可以使用以下命令验证网络配置是否成功:
查看IP地址:
ip addr show enp0s3
测试网络连接:
ping 8.8.8.8
如果你需要从外部访问Ubuntu服务器,可能需要配置SSH服务。编辑 /etc/ssh/sshd_config 文件:
sudo nano /etc/ssh/sshd_config
确保以下配置项设置为:
PermitRootLogin yes
然后重启SSH服务:
sudo systemctl restart sshd
你可以使用 ufw 来配置防火墙规则,例如开放SSH端口:
sudo ufw allow 22/tcp
sudo ufw enable
如果你需要修改主机名,可以编辑 /etc/hostname 文件:
sudo nano /etc/hostname
如果你需要配置APT软件源,可以编辑 /etc/apt/sources.list 文件:
sudo nano /etc/apt/sources.list
添加你选择的APT源,然后保存并退出编辑器。运行以下命令更新软件包列表:
sudo apt update
通过以上步骤,你应该能够在Ubuntu系统上完成基本的网络配置。根据你的具体需求,可能还需要进行其他配置,例如设置静态路由、多网卡配置等。